Eastward is a beautifully detailed and charming adventure RPG, from Shanghai-based indie developers, Pixpil and published by Chucklefish. Escape the tyrannical clutches of a subterranean society and join Eastward’s unlikely duo on an exciting adventure to the land above! Discover beautiful yet bizarre settlements and make new friends as you travel across the world by rail. Inspired by 90s Japanese animation, the visual style of Eastward has been brought to life using a combination of a modern, innovative 3D lighting system and a rich retro-pixel artwork.
What it’s like
Eastward delivers a poignant, character-driven journey through a vibrant post-apocalyptic world that feels both desolate and hopeful. The experience centers on the evolving bond between John, a weary miner, and Sam, a mysterious girl with unique abilities, as they traverse diverse biomes by rail and foot. Visually, it is a standout achievement, blending crisp pixel art with modern 3D lighting to create a lush, atmospheric aesthetic inspired by 90s anime. The narrative unfolds through charming dialogue and environmental storytelling, prioritizing emotional resonance over complex plot twists. Gameplay involves light puzzle-solving and exploration, with combat serving as a functional but simple backdrop to the adventure. The tone balances whimsical charm with underlying melancholy, creating a cohesive and heartfelt experience that emphasizes discovery and connection rather than mechanical mastery.
